Skip to main content

Role

Overview​

Definition​

(Elucidation) A role b is a realizable entity such that b exists because there is some single bearer that is in some special physical, social, or institutional set of circumstances in which this bearer does not have to be & b is not such that, if it ceases to exist, then the physical make-up of the bearer is thereby changed

Examples​

The priest role; the student role; the role of subject in a clinical trial; the role of a stone in marking a property boundary; the role of a boundary to demarcate two neighbouring administrative territories; the role of a building in serving as a military target

Aliases​

externally-grounded realizable entity

URI​

http://purl.obolibrary.org/obo/BFO_0000023

Subclass Of​

Ontology Reference​

Properties​

Data Properties​

OntologyLabelDefinitionExampleDomainRange
abiis curated in foundryRelates a class to the foundry it is curated in.The class cco:ont00001262 is curated in the foundry 'enterprise_management_foundry' and 'personal_ai_foundry'.entitystring
abidata propertyA data property is a property that is used to represent a data property.entitystring

Object Properties​

OntologyLabelDefinitionExampleDomainRangeInverse Of
abihas backing data sourceRelates an entity to the data source that provides the underlying data for that entity. This property indicates the origin or source of the data that supports the entity.A report entity may have a backing data source that provides the raw data used to generate the report.entityData Source-
abihas template classRelates a subject to its template class.entityTemplate Class-
bfoexists at(Elucidation) exists at is a relation between a particular and some temporal region at which the particular existsFirst World War exists at 1914-1916; Mexico exists at January 1, 2000entitytemporal region-
bfocontinuant part ofb continuant part of c = Def b and c are continuants & there is some time t such that b and c exist at t & b continuant part of c at tMilk teeth continuant part of human; surgically removed tumour continuant part of organismcontinuantcontinuanthas continuant part
bfohas continuant partb has continuant part c = Def c continuant part of bcontinuantcontinuant-
ccois output ofx is_output_of y iff x is an instance of Continuant and y is an instance of Process, such that the presence of x at the end of y is a necessary condition for the completion of y.continuantprocesshas output
ccois input ofx is_input_of y iff x is an instance of Continuant and y is an instance of Process, such that the presence of x at the beginning of y is a necessary condition for the start of y.continuantprocesshas input
ccois affected byx is_affected_by y iff x is an instance of Continuant and y is an instance of Process, and y influences x in some manner, most often by producing a change in x.continuantprocess-
bfospecifically depends on(Elucidation) specifically depends on is a relation between a specifically dependent continuant b and specifically dependent continuant or independent continuant that is not a spatial region c such that b and c share no parts in common & b is of a nature such that at all times t it cannot exist unless c exists & b is not a boundary of cA shape specifically depends on the shaped object; hue, saturation and brightness of a colour sample specifically depends on each otherspecifically dependent continuant{'or': ['http://purl.obolibrary.org/obo/BFO_0000020', {'and': ['http://purl.obolibrary.org/obo/BFO_0000004', {'not': ['http://purl.obolibrary.org/obo/BFO_0000006']}]}]}-
bfoinheres inb inheres in c = Def b is a specifically dependent continuant & c is an independent continuant that is not a spatial region & b specifically depends on cA shape inheres in a shaped object; a mass inheres in a material entityspecifically dependent continuant{'and': ['http://purl.obolibrary.org/obo/BFO_0000004', {'not': ['http://purl.obolibrary.org/obo/BFO_0000006']}]}-
bfohas realizationb has realization c = Def c realizes bAs for realizesrealizable entityprocessrealizes
is realized byrealizable entityprocess-
is capability ofrealizable entitymaterial entity-
ccorole of aggregatex role_of_aggregate y iff y is an instance of Object Aggregate and x is an instance of Role, and x inheres_in_aggregate y.roleobject aggregate-
ccois subordinate role toFor all x,y,t: y is subordinate role to x at t iff: x is an instance of Role at time t, and y is an instance of Role at time t, and there is some z such that x is realized by z and z is an instance of Process which creates, modifies, transfers, or eliminates some u such that u is a Process Regulation at time t, and u is addressed to the bearer of y.rolerolehas subordinate role
ccohas subordinate roleFor all x,y,t: x has subordinate role y at t iff: x is an instance of Role at time t, and y is an instance of Role at time t, and there is some z such that x is realized by z and z is an instance of Process which creates, modifies, transfers, or eliminates some u such that u is a Process Regulation at time t, and u is addressed to the bearer of y.rolerole-
ccohas organizational contextx has_organizational_context y iff y is an instance of an Organization and x is an instance of a Role and z is an instance of a Person, such that z's affiliation with y is a prerequisite for z bearing x or y ascribes x to the bearer of x.roleOrganization-